The
Greeters Unit was inspired by its first president, William Scroggs, Sr. It
was organized in 1943 with the
approval of Potentate Harry M. Dort. The Greeters are
the Temple's official reception committee. Prior to all
Temple Stated Meetings, the uniformed Greeters are posted at all entrances to
welcome all Nobles, ladies
and visitors. As a Unit, Greeters participate in all
parades, either riding in their open-sided bus or walking along
side waving and saying "Hi" to everyone. Fund raisers, such as the annual
breakfast, enable the Greeters to
make contributions throughout the year to the Al Bahr General Fund and others.
The Greeter Creed, written by the late 1949 Past President, Dave Bell, best
describes this active unit.
